In India addressing vehicle emissions is a crucial step towards combating air pollution. Every motor vehicle owner is required to possess a valid Pollution Under Control (PUC) certificate which confirms that their vehicle meets the specified emission standards. This certificate plays a vital role in promoting cleaner air by ensuring that vehicle emissions remain within permissible limits.

Traditionally obtaining a PUC certificate involved visiting accredited examination centers for in-person verification. However with the advancement of digitalization many Joint Service Stations (JSSKs) and Regional Transport Offices (RTOs) now offer streamlined processes for obtaining these certificates.

How to Renew Your PUC Online

Before proceeding with online PUC renewal check if this service is available in your state:

1. Visit the Parivahan Sewa Website: Navigate to the "Online Services" section and select your state.
  
2. Check for PUC Renewal Option: Look for details related to "Pollution Under Control Certificate" to confirm availability.

If your state offers online PUC renewal follow these steps:

1. Gather Required Information: Have your vehicle registration number the last five digits of your chassis number and your mobile number linked to the vehicle ready.

2. Visit the RTO Website or Mobile App: Access the official platform of your state's RTO offering online services.

3. Register or Login: If it's your first time register by providing necessary details and linking your vehicle information.

4. Navigate to PUC Renewal Section: Find and select the option for PUC renewal or online services.

5. Enter Vehicle Details: Input your registration number and chassis number digits to retrieve your vehicle information.

6. Pay the PUC Fee: Choose your preferred payment method and proceed with the online payment.

7. Download the PUC Certificate: Upon successful payment download a soft copy of your renewed PUC certificate from the platform.

Alternatives and Penalties

If online renewal isn't available or feasible:

Visit an Authorized PUC Testing Center: Locate a testing center where your vehicle emissions will be tested for compliance.
 
Penalties for Non-Compliance: Driving without a valid PUC certificate can lead to fines and vehicle impoundment under the Motor Vehicles Act 1988. Ensure timely renewal to avoid such penalties.
